RS 37:1201: Unlawful practice

A. Except as otherwise provided in this Chapter, it shall be unlawful for any individual to engage in the practice of pharmacy unless currently licensed or registered to practice under the provisions of this Chapter.

B. Licensed practitioners authorized under the laws of this state to compound drugs and to dispense drugs to their patients in the practice of their respective professions shall meet the same standards, record keeping requirements, and all other requirements for the dispensing of drugs applicable to pharmacists.

C. It shall be unlawful for any individual to assist in the practice of pharmacy unless currently registered or certified by the board.
